Subject: Verdandi scheduler plugin hooks

Hello plugin authors,

The Verdandi plant-watering scheduler now exposes pre-watering and post-watering hooks. Please register callbacks with explicit timeouts; unhandled delays will pause the entire zone queue. Moisture readings arrive as integers, scaled by one hundred, so convert carefully before thresholding. Sandbox calls to the hook registry must include the bearer token directly below.

Best,
Otava Integrations

session JWT of tadup-kaguf = eyJhbGciOiJIUzI1NiIsInR5cCI6IkpXVCJ9.eyJzdWIiOiItNz4V3In0.KrZCeqpk

Ticket: Staging env misconfigured for Siftgate bloom filter

The bloom layer in front of the Pellet KV store is rejecting all lookups in staging because the env file was copied from the dev template without credentials. False-positive tuning values are fine; only the auth line is missing. To unblock the weekly demo, the Pellet admission secret must be set on the following line.

env line for yaguf-fajop: LEDGER_TOKEN13=fb08984397349

Ticket VLT-0883: Vault locked — Ladlefox recipe-scaling calculator

The secrets vault holding the Ladlefox calculator's conversion tables locked itself after a failed deploy on Thursday. Scaling requests now return stale ratios for batch sizes over 40 servings. As the contractor picking this up, unseal the vault before redeploying, then verify the metric conversions. The unseal phrase is provided immediately below.

recovery phrase for bajog-kadug: lamion-novdor-oliix-belox-nordor-praeth-sorael